当前位置:首页 > 数据库 > 正文

jquery获取元素位置?获取元素相对于父元素位置

jquery获取元素位置?获取元素相对于父元素位置

如何使用jQuery获取父元素1、jQuery获取父元素的三种方式有:.parent()、.parents()、.clost()。下面详细介绍这些方法及示例。.pare...

如何使用jQuery获取父元素

1、jQuery获取父元素的三种方式有:.parent()、.parents()、.clost()。下面详细介绍这些方法及示例。.parent() 方法返回被选元素的直接父元素。例如,若要获取元素的直接父元素并进行操作,可使用此方法。.parents() 方法不仅返回父元素,还返回被选元素的所有祖先元素。

2、parent([expr])取得一个包含着所有匹配元素的唯一父元素的元素。你可以使用可选的表达式来筛选。

3、jquery获取父元素比如;parent(),parents,clost(),这些都可以查找父元素或节点,具体步骤如下:parent([expr])用一个包含着所有匹配元素的唯一父元素的元素。你用可选的表达式来筛选。

4、p).parent().parent(.x).css(background, yellow);将 parent() 再一次,不过第二次 parent() 要有 .x,如果没有,那第二个 p 的 parent 的 parent 就变成 body 了。

相关问答


问:jquery获取元素位置?获取元素相对于父元素位置-?

答:哎呀,在 jQuery 里获取元素相对于父元素的位置,可以用 offset() 方法哟。

通过这个方法就能得到元素的位置信息啦。

比如说元素距离父元素的左、上偏移量啥的,是不是还挺方便的呀?

问:jquery获取元素的父元素?

答:哎呀,在 jQuery 中获取元素的父元素很简单啦!可以使用 `parent()` 方法哟。

比如说,假设你有个元素叫 `$element` ,那获取它的父元素就写成 `$element.parent()` ,这样就能轻松得到啦!是不是很方便呀?

问:jquery获取当前元素是第几个元素?

答:嘿呀,在 jQuery 中获取当前元素是第几个元素可以这样做哦。

先给相关元素一个共同的类名,然后使用 `index()` 方法就能得到啦。

比如 `$('.myClass').index(this)` ,这样就能知道当前元素在这组元素中的位置啦,是不是还挺简单的呀?

问:jquery获取当前元素的父元素?

答:哎呀,在 jQuery 里获取当前元素的父元素很简单啦!可以用 `parent()` 方法哟。

比如 `$(this).parent()` ,这里的 `$(this)` 表示当前元素,这样就能获取到它的父元素啦!是不是挺方便的呀?

最新文章